Job Summary
To ensure compliance with federal laws and regulations, the full-time remote Plan Document Analyst will draft, revise, and maintain ERISA-compliant Plan Documents, Summary Plan Descriptions, and ACA-compliant Summaries of Benefits and Coverages while collaborating with various teams and stakeholders.
Key responsibilities
- Develops and maintains Plan Documents and amendments, ensuring timely approval from the Plan Administrator
- Analyzes and resolves issues reported by users and collaborates with Legal to address compliance concerns
- Maintains electronic storage of Plan Documents and provides support to the Benefit Team and internal staff
Required q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Technical Writing, Business, Healthcare Management, or related field, or five years of relevant experience
- Minimum of three years' experience in writing documentation or instructional materials
- Minimum of three years' analysis and/or research experience
- In-depth knowledge of managed care, health insurance, or third-party administrative services
- Project Management experience preferred
